A Balkan cornmeal porridge cooked thick, then finished with white cheese and paprika butter.

Bring the water and salt to a boil in a pot.
Add the cornmeal gradually, stirring constantly.
Cook the porridge over low heat until thickened.
Foam the butter with the red pepper flakes.
Transfer the kachamak to a bowl and serve with cheese and pepper butter.
💡 Tip: Do not pour in the cornmeal all at once; adding it in a thin stream gives a smooth, spoonable texture.
🍽️ Serving suggestion: Serve kachamak hot with cheese, yogurt, and roasted peppers for breakfast or a light dinner.
